Rent A Car Sri Lanka Secrets
Furthermore, some rental corporations might demand the first renter to get present when finding up the automobile, so it’s most effective to check With all the rental company for their certain guidelines.When you rent a vehicle in Sri Lanka, you will need to generate about the left side and overtake on the ideal aspect from the road. Unless if no